Adoption Info of Arkansas Fire Sprinkler Code 2019
Official title 2019 Arkansas Fire Sprinkler Code
Effective dates January 1, 2019 – Present
Adopts with amendments NFPA 13, Standard for the Installation of Sprinkler Systems, 2016 Edition

Overview The NFPA 13 standard provides comprehensive requirements for the design, installation, and maintenance of fire sprinkler systems. It includes guidelines for water supply, system components, installation practices, and testing to ensure the effectiveness and reliability of fire sprinkler systems in protecting life and property from fire.
The 2019 Arkansas Fire Sprinkler Code adopts the NFPA 13, 2016 Edition, with specific amendments tailored to Arkansas’s unique conditions. These modifications ensure that fire sprinkler systems in Arkansas meet high standards of safety, performance, and reliability, addressing local environmental and regulatory requirements.
